Both of those jobs can use about 50-100 watts At 1C it is 40 and at 2C it is 80 maybe. I would consider the two Tritons, Triton EQ for 50-63 watts and the Triton 2 EQ at 100-120 watts. They both have the balancer and the ac/dc you want. If you get the bigger one you may double up on packs in the future and not run out of power so quickly.
